Fermented dairy likely developed independently across several pastoral cultures in Central Asia and the Middle East thousands of years ago, probably discovered by accident when milk carried in animal-skin containers fermented naturally in warm climates. It became a dietary staple across an enormous geographic range, each region developing its own distinct fermentation traditions.
Yogurt's modern scientific reputation owes a considerable debt to Russian Nobel laureate Élie Metchnikoff, whose early 20th-century observations of long-lived, yogurt-consuming Bulgarian peasants helped launch the entire modern field of research into fermented foods and gut health.
Fermented dairy has real, replicated evidence for blood pressure specifically. Multiple independent meta-analyses have found significant reductions: one review of 9 trials (543 participants) found probiotic consumption, mostly via fermented dairy, significantly reduced systolic blood pressure by 3.56 mmHg and diastolic by 2.38 mmHg, and a separate meta-analysis of 14 trials found similar reductions. Worth flagging transparently: one prominent meta-analysis on this exact topic was subsequently retracted, a genuine red flag worth weighing, even though it doesn't invalidate the other independently-conducted positive reviews.
For blood sugar management specifically, the picture is more clearly negative: a meta-analysis of 9 randomized controlled trials found no significant benefit of probiotic yogurt on HbA1c, fasting glucose, or insulin resistance in people with type 2 diabetes or obesity. This split — real, replicated blood pressure benefit (with one important retraction noted) but explicitly no benefit for glycemic control — is why "Limited-Moderate" is the accurate, honest rating.
